Summary

Read the book that Ali Standish (author of The Ethan I Was Before) calls "a heartwarming story" and Melissa Roske (author of Kat Greene Comes Clean) calls "a joyful, heartfelt debut!" 
Thirteen-year-old Jamie Bunn made a mistake at the end of the school year. A big one. And every kid in her middle school knows all about it. Now she has to spend her summer vacation volunteering at the local library—as punishment. What a waste of a summer! 
Or so she thinks. 
A Kind of Paradise is an unforgettable story about the power of community, the power of the library, and the power of forgiveness.

    A young boy named Aladdin is approached by a wicked magician and is asked to go into a cave and search for a magic lamp. Aladdin tricks the magician and keeps the lamp for himself. He uses the power of the lamp to marry a beautiful princess. The wicked magician gets the lamp back and uses the power to move Aladdin and the princess far away. Once again Aladdin tricks the wicked magician and gets the lamp back.
